POWER
One lift of the hood is all it takes to throw the all-business, black-tie subtlety of this car's sleek exterior right out the driver's window. Perfectly wedged between the fenders, BMW's Formula One-inspired 5.0 liter S85 V10 blends an impressive 500 horsepower and 380 lb./ft. of smooth torque. Designed as a high-revving, all-aluminum thoroughbred that utilizes a wide power band to create over 100 horsepower per liter, the S85 combines 12 to 1 compression with an astonishing 8,250 RPM redline. Notable hardware includes a forged steel crank, forged Mahle pistons, variable valve timing, ten individually controlled throttle butterflies, quasi-dry-sump lubrication and 4-valve, CNC-machined cylinder heads. However, despite that host of track-proven upgrades, none of the car's traditional BMW silk has been compromised: this coupe behaves as a well-mannered executive express until your right foot outweighs your better judgment. DRIVABILITY AND ATHLETICISM
Naturally, a powerhouse like the S85 V10 needs a whole lot of top notch hardware to back it up. Originally, the M6 could only be optioned with a 7-speed sequential manual slushbox. But luckily, the row-it-yourself brigade made so much noise that BMW eventually threw in a traditional Getrag 6-speed. That slick-shifting manual, one of only 323 installed in 2006-2010 M6 coupes, sends power to a standard limited-slip differential. An electronic, driver-selectable suspension, comprised of Macpherson strut front and multi-link rear set-ups, makes excellent use of the car's 50/50 weight distribution. Stops are provided by four cross-drilled discs, which are monitored by standard anti-lock technology. M Dynamic Stability Control, M All Season Traction Control and fully electronic brake distribution turn that already serious performance into serious curve carving prowess. And the final piece of the performance upgrade is a set of positively gorgeous M wheels, which wear 255/40ZR19 Continental Extreme Contact radials in front of 285/35ZR19 Continental Extreme Contact radials.
